DB2のエラーコード42884の解決方法は何ですか?

DB2のエラーコード42884は、オブジェクトが存在しないか無効であることを示しており、通常は存在しないテーブルや列、他のオブジェクトを参照する場合に発生します。この問題を解決するためには、次の手順に従うことができます。

  1. SQL文で使用しているすべてのオブジェクト(テーブル名、列名など)が存在し、スペルミスがないか確認してください。
  2. 引用されたオブジェクトにアクセス権が十分であることを確認するために、データベース管理者に認可を依頼する必要があります。
  3. もし別名を使っている場合は、その別名が実際の名前と一致していることを確認してください。
  4. 複数のデータベースを接続する際にこのエラーが発生した場合は、完全修飾されたオブジェクト名(例:データベース名.テーブル名)を使用してオブジェクトを参照してみてください。
  5. もし上記の方法で問題が解決しない場合は、参照されているオブジェクトを再作成するか、データベース管理者にさらなる診断と対処を依頼してみてください。

以上の手順に従えば、DB2のエラーコード42884を解決できるはずです。もし問題が解決しない場合は、DB2の公式ドキュメントを参照するか、IBMのテクニカルサポートチームに連絡してさらなる支援を受けることを検討してください。

bannerAds